Understanding Disc Protrusion
Disc protrusion, also known as a herniated disc, occurs when the inner core of the disc bulges out through the outer layer. This can put pressure on the surrounding nerves, causing pain, numbness, and weakness in the back, legs, or arms. It is essential to differentiate between disc protrusion and other spinal conditions to ensure an accurate diagnosis.
Common Symptoms of Disc Protrusion
Some common symptoms of disc protrusion include sharp or shooting pain in the back, legs, or arms, numbness or tingling in the affected area, and muscle weakness. These symptoms can vary in intensity depending on the location and severity of the herniated disc. Imaging Tests for Diagnosing Disc Protrusion
In addition to a physical examination, imaging tests are often used to confirm a diagnosis of disc protrusion. These tests provide detailed images of the spine and help healthcare providers visualize the herniated disc, its location, and any associated nerve compression. Common imaging tests used in diagnosing disc protrusion include X-rays, MRI scans, and CT scans.
Understanding X-Rays, MRI Scans, and CT Scans
- X-Rays: X-rays provide a two-dimensional image of the spine and can help identify structural abnormalities such as bone spurs or fractures. While X-rays are useful in ruling out certain conditions, they may not provide detailed information about soft tissues like discs.
- MRI Scans: MRI scans use magnetic fields and radio waves to create detailed images of the spinal cord, discs, and nerves. They are particularly useful in visualizing soft tissues and can help healthcare providers identify the size, location, and impact of a herniated disc.
- CT Scans: CT scans use a series of X-ray images to create cross-sectional images of the spine. They can provide detailed information about the bony structures and nerve roots affected by a herniated disc. CT scans are often used in conjunction with MRI scans for a comprehensive evaluation.
Electromyography (EMG) and Nerve Conduction Studies
In some cases, healthcare providers may recommend electromyography (EMG) and nerve conduction studies to assess nerve function and identify nerve damage associated with disc protrusion. These tests involve measuring the electrical activity of muscles and nerves, providing valuable information about the extent of nerve compression and potential complications.
The Role of EMG and Nerve Conduction Studies
- Electromyography (EMG): EMG involves inserting small needles into the muscles to measure their electrical activity. This test can help healthcare providers determine if there is nerve damage or muscle weakness caused by a herniated disc.
- Nerve Conduction Studies: Nerve conduction studies involve applying small electrical shocks to the nerves and measuring how quickly the signals travel. This test can help identify nerve compression and assess the severity of nerve damage resulting from disc protrusion.

Treatment Options for Disc Protrusion
Once a diagnosis of disc protrusion is confirmed, healthcare providers will develop a treatment plan tailored to the patient’s specific needs and symptoms. Treatment options for disc protrusion may include conservative measures such as physical therapy, medications, and injections, as well as surgical interventions for severe cases. The goal of treatment is to relieve pain, improve function, and prevent complications associated with the herniated disc.
Conservative Treatments for Disc Protrusion
- Physical Therapy: Physical therapy focuses on strengthening the muscles, improving flexibility, and correcting posture to alleviate pressure on the spine. Therapists may use a combination of exercises, manual techniques, and modalities to reduce pain and improve function.
- Medications: Nonsteroidal anti-inflammatory drugs (NSAIDs), muscle relaxants, and pain relievers are commonly prescribed to manage pain and inflammation associated with disc protrusion. In some cases, corticosteroid injections may be recommended to reduce swelling and alleviate symptoms.
- Lifestyle Modifications: Lifestyle modifications such as maintaining a healthy weight, practicing good posture, and avoiding activities that aggravate symptoms can help manage disc protrusion. Adopting ergonomic workstations and practicing proper lifting techniques are also important for preventing further injury.
Surgical Interventions for Severe Disc Protrusion
- Discectomy: Discectomy is a surgical procedure that involves removing the herniated portion of the disc to relieve pressure on the nerves. This minimally invasive procedure can be performed using a small incision and specialized instruments, resulting in faster recovery and reduced risk of complications.
- Laminectomy: Laminectomy is a surgical procedure that involves removing a portion of the lamina, the bony arch of the spine, to decompress the nerves affected by disc protrusion. This procedure is often recommended for severe cases of nerve compression and spinal instability.

Lifestyle Modifications for Preventing Disc Protrusion
In addition to medical treatment and rehabilitation, making lifestyle modifications can help prevent disc protrusion and reduce the risk of recurrent herniation. Adopting healthy habits, practicing good posture, and avoiding activities that strain the spine can significantly decrease the likelihood of developing disc protrusion in the future.
Recommended Lifestyle Modifications for Preventing Disc Protrusion
- Maintain a Healthy Weight: Excess weight can put additional pressure on the spine, increasing the risk of disc protrusion. Maintaining a healthy weight through diet and exercise can help reduce strain on the spine and prevent herniated discs.
- Practice Good Posture: Poor posture can contribute to spinal imbalances and increase the risk of disc protrusion. Practicing good posture during daily activities, sitting, standing, and lifting can help maintain spinal alignment and reduce pressure on the discs.
- Stay Active: Regular exercise and physical activity can help strengthen the muscles, improve flexibility, and support the spine. Engaging in low-impact activities such as swimming, walking, or yoga can promote spinal health and reduce the risk of disc protrusion.
